
Legrand has announced the UK launch of a portfolio of single phase UPS systems. The range includes five UPS solutions: Keor DC, Keor PDU, Keor SP, Keor SPE and Keor SPE RT.
The Keor DC solution is a UPS designed to back up all internet connected devices such as modems, routers, cordless or VoIP phones. The Keor PDU is a PDU style UPS designed for installation in 19-inch racks with 8 IEC sockets
Keor SP, Keor SPE and Keor SPE RT are all single phase line interactive UPS systems of varying power availability and size. The Keor SPE RT is a rackmount unit while the other two are tower units.
The products are new to the UK market after initially being launched in mainland Europe. Legrand has established an extensive distribution network in other markets and is looking to do the same in the UK.

The new range of single phase UPS systems have been designed to address specific market requirements. Use cases include power protection for networking equipment, and delivering optimised power security for racks.
